Bulma, the attractive teenage daughter of the Pok� Ball Corporation,
stood in the shade of a large rock, staring at a small device in her
hand. The blistering desert sun shone brightly all around while her
young companion, Son Goku, sat on the ground looking unhappy.
"I'm hungry," Goku complained, as his stomach rumbled loudly.
"Well, I guess we should stop for a rest," said Bulma, looking up from
her device. "According to the Pok� Radar, we're definitely headed
toward the next of the Legendary Pok� Balls." Bulma sat down next to
the young boy who, strangely enough, had a tail.
"According to the legend, each of the Seven Legendary Pok� Balls
contains one of the Seven Legendary Pok�mon. If I can find all seven,
I'll be the most famous pok�mon trainer in the world!" Bulma's spoke
with such fierce desire that even Goku almost forgot about his empty
stomach.
"Why would you want to do that?" Goku asked.
"Because then I'll be able to marry a cute and powerful Pok�mon Master!
" Bulma said, her eyes distant as she imagined hundreds of handsome
young men all begging for a date with her.
"You're weird," Goku commented, but Bulma was too far gone to hear him.
Not far away, a young man spied the two travelers. His name was
Yamucha, and he was known far and wide as the Desert Pok�bandit. Anyone
passing through his desert was fair game, and few pok�mon trainers had
ever defeated him in a pok�mon battle. However, he had one great
weakness.
"Oh no," he whispered as he watched the two intruders with a terrified
expression. "It's a girl!" Yamucha was torn, faced with the choice of
defending his reputation or giving in to the primal instinct that was
telling him to run like hell.
Goku, meanwhile, had taken out his grandfather's pok� ball. Bulma had
insisted that it was one of the Legendary Pok� Balls, and had
practically forced him to join her on her quest. His stomach growled
again, and Goku momentarily wondered if the Legendary Pok�mon that was
supposed to be inside would be good to eat. Nearby, Bulma had decided
to lie down for a short nap. Goku was bored. As Bulma slept, he
watched the shadow of the rock slowly move across the ground. As he
watched, suddenly the shadow got larger and he knew they weren't alone.
"Who's there!?!" he yelled, jumping up and facing the rock. Bulma was
suddenly wide awake, and she quickly reached for her backpack containing
the Pok� Balls and the Pok�radar. Unfortunately, the bright sunlight
obscured Goku's vision, and he couldn't see. As it turned out, he
didn't need to worry, because the intruders were more than happy to
introduce themselves.
"Prepare for trouble," said a female voice.
"And make it double," added a male voice.
"No, not you again!" Bulma cried. Oblivious to her cries, the two
voices continued their speech, alternating lines.
"To protect the world from devestation,"
"To unite all people within our nation,"
"To denounce the evils of truth and love,"
"To extend our reach to the stars above,"
Leaping down from the rock to face the two travelers, the duo called out
their names.
"Magenta!" An attractive young woman posed dramatically. She had
bright pink hair and wore a white uniform with a large red "R" on the
chest.
"Cornflower!" An equally attractive young man with purplish-blue hair
and a matching uniform struck an equally dramatic pose.
"Red Rocket Army, blast off at the speed of light!" announced Magenta.
"Surrender now, or prepare to fight!" finished Cornflower.
"Meowth, that's right!" A small, feline pok�mon jumped down from the
rock and stood between the two members of the Red Rocket Army, pointing
at Bulma's backpack. "And you're going to give us those Pok� Balls!"
"Cornflower?" asked Bulma, trying not to laugh. "What kind of name is
Cornflower?"
"Well, Blue, Violet, and Purple were already taken," answered
'Cornflower' defensively, "so I had to look through a box of crayons to
find an appropriate name."
"I like your name, James," said 'Magenta'. "In fact, I really think it
suits you."
"Do you really think so, Jess?" asked 'Cornflower' happily.
"Can we get on with this!?!" yelled an irritated Meowth.
"You won't take these Pok� Balls without a fight," said Bulma, reaching
into her backpack. "Oolong, I choose you!!" she called, throwing a pok�
ball that opened to reveal a small pig wearing a white shirt, green
pants, and suspenders.
"Whatd'ya want now!?!" asked Oolong, "I was in the middle of something
important. Do you mind?" Closer examination revealed a magazine of
questionable taste that he'd tried to hide in the back of his pants.
"Now you listen to me, you lazy perverted porker! You're MY pok�mon,
and you're going to follow MY orders," Bulma yelled, her hands clenched
into fists of rage.
"Oh yeah? Who's gonna make me?" asked Oolong, sneering.
"I'm hungry," Goku complained loudly, as no one was paying any attention
to him.
Cornflower and Magenta watched the argument unfold in silence, while
large sweatdrops appeared on the backs of their heads.
"Uh oh," Yamucha said, watching the confrontation. "It looks like
they're in trouble. But why should I help them?" Yamucha continued to
watch with growing unease.
"It's not like I'd be helping them," he reasoned to himself, "I just
don't like the Red Rocket Army. I'm doing myself a favor. That's all."
Yamucha pulled out a pok� ball. "Puaru, I choose you!" he called and a
small blue floating cat emerged from the pok� ball.
"Yamucha-sama?" the cat asked.
"Puaru, I want to you to help me get rid of those Red Rocket Army
troublemakers."
"ENOUGH ALREADY!!" yelled Meowth. "You two, get those Pok� Balls!"
Magenta and Cornflower pulled out their own pok� balls and activated
them.
"Number 6, I choose you!"
"Number 7, go!"
The pok�mon that came from the Red Rocket Army's balls were like no
pok�mon Bulma had ever seen. Number 6 vaguely resembled a snake, but
it's stilted movements and souless eyes betrayed it's unnatural origins.
Number 7 was even more odd, a floating, pulsating mass of gears and
flesh that emitted a foul, sickening gas.
"What are those?" Bulma asked, her eyes wide.
"Meowth! These are the ultimate fighting creations of the Red Rocket
Army! Jinzoupok�mon 6 and 7!" Meowth grinned confidently. "With these
artificial pok�mon, the Red Rocket Army will soon rule the world. The
only thing that could possibly stand in our way are the 7 Legendary
Pok�mon. And soon we'll have those too!"
"Oolong, we've gotta stop these guys. Machine gun attack!!" Bulma
ordered the little pig bravely, but there was fear in her eyes.
"You got it!" the pig answered, and his entire body suddenly transformed
into a piece of living artillery. He fired at the Jinzoupok�mon, but
the bullets bounced right off their tough hides.
"No good!" Bulma cried nervously.
"You fools, you'll never win againt the Red Rocket Army," boasted
Magenta.
"Puaru, ballistic missle attack, now!!" called a voice. A handsome
young man appeared nearby. Next to Oolong, an ICBM suddenly popped out
of nowhere and launched it's payload directly at the two artificial
pok�mon.
"Wow! Where'd that come from?" asked Goku, amazed.
"I'm Yamucha, the Desert Pok�bandit, and this is my territory,"
announced the young man. "The Red Rocket Army doesn't belong here. I
think you should leave!" Yamucha stood proudly and spoke with a
dangerous glint in his eyes.
"He's SO CUTE!!" Bulma squealed. Yamucha blushed furiously, and looked
away. The missle exploded, stirring up a huge cloud of sand and smoke.
Bulma covered her face with her hand and tried to keep from being
knocked off balace by the shock of the explosion.
"Take that, Red Rocket Army!" she yelled. However, as the smoke cleared
she gasped with amazement. The Jinzoupok�mon weren't even scratched.
"You singed my hair!!" cried Cornflower, holding the charred ends in
front of his face.
"You ruined my complexion!!" cried the equally upset Magenta, who's
soot-covered face had turned bright red from the heat of the explosion.
"Number 6, acid attack!!""Number 7, poison gas attack!!"
The two Jinzoupok�mon moved forward, and the snake-like Number 6
suddenly spit at Oolong. He jumped backward in fear.
"Yeowch!! What the?" He watched in terror as the place he had just
been standing dissolved and left a deep crater in the ground.
"That's it, I'm out of here!" he said, and with a red glow he returned,
unbidden, to his pok� ball.
"YOU COWARD!!" yelled Bulma.
"Puaru!" called Yamucha, amazed that his first attack had failed.
"Yes, Yamucha-sama?" asked the floating blue cat, reappearing in front
of his master. However, at that moment Number 7 expelled a noxious
cloud of blue gas. Bulma, Yamucha, and Puaru were all caught in the
blast, and all three suddenly found themselves coughing and unable to
breathe. Bulma fell to her knees.
"Hey you, leave my friends alone!" Goku yelled, forgetting about his
hunger.
"Oh, what are you going to do about it, brat?" asked Magenta, smirking.
Goku reached behind his back and pulled out a staff."Oh, he's got a
stick. How frightening," mocked Cornflower. He and Magenta laughed.
"I'm warning you, leave my friends alone." Goku crouched, ready to
attack. Meowth noticed as Goku reached to put his Pok� Ball back in his
pouch.
"Meowth! It's your unlucky day, kid," Meowth said, "We're the Red
Rocket Army, and we're not leaving without every one of the Legendary
Pok� Balls, and that includes yours!"
"You leave my grandfather's Pok� Ball alone!" Goku cried, leaping
towards the Jinzoupok�mon. However, Number 6 moved surprisingly fast,
and used it's tail to knock the staff out the boy's hand while knocking
the boy backward into the rock. He hit it with a loud crack, and the
rock split in two.
"Siksssssss," it said in a hissing voice. It coiled itself, and then
suddenly sprang forward, straight at Goku. Goku rolled out of the way
at the last second and the snake-like pok�mon ran head first into the
cracked rock.
"Number 6!" Magenta ran over to the injured Jinzoupokmon.
"Owwww," Goku cried, slowly standing up, shaking his head to clear it.
Looking up, he found himself face-to-face with Number 7. Number 7
sprayed a foul green gas straight into Goku's face. Goku, blinded by
the gas, stumbled forward.
"Alright Number 7!! Finish him!" yelled Cornflower triumphantly.
"The smell!" he cried, holding his nose. Number 7 flew down and rammed
Goku in the stomach, causing him to double over as the breath was
knocked out of him.
"Goku!" Bulma yelled, still on her knees. "Use the Legendary Pok�mon!"
Goku felt the Pok� Ball in his pouch and hesitated. Through watering
eyes, he saw Number 7 preparing for another attack, while Number 6 had
nearly recovered. Reaching for his Pok� Ball, he pushed the button.
Yamucha watched the battle between the boy with the tail and the
Jinzoupok�mon unfold. He felt helpless, but he knew that even Puaru
couldn't fight such strong monsters. He'd returned his pok�mon to it's
pok� ball as soon as the poisonous gas enveloped them. Next to him, he
heard Bulma tell the boy to use the Legendary Pok�mon. Yamucha couldn't
believe his ears.
"You mean you HAVE Legendary Pok�mon?" he asked incredulously.
"Yes, I'm going to be the most famous pok�mon trainer in the world!"
Bulma responded.
"Well then WHY DIDN'T YOU USE THEM EARLIER!!" he demanded.
"Um, well, I didn't think about it," Bulma answered, smiling brightly.
Yamucha sank to his knees.
"Is that. . . ?" Bulma asked, pointing looking at the place where Goku
had stood. Yamucha looked up. Goku had disappeared, and in front of
them there was instead a giant ape, that was growing larger by the
second. It seemed to glow with an inner light, and there was a sense of
savageness in it that could not be tamed by man.
"The Legendary Pok�mon, Oozaru," Yamucha breathed. Bulma pulled out her
Pok�dex and aimed it at the giant monkey.
"Legendary Pok�mon Oozaru," identified the tinny voice of the Pok�dex.
"Believed to be one of the most savage and fierce of all pok�mon. No
furthur information available."
"What is that!" asked Magenta, as she and Cornflower grabbed each other
in fear.
"I think it's a giant monkey," answered Cornflower.
"You two are pathetic," said Meowth. "Jinzoupok�mon, get that thing!"
he ordered. The two artificial pok�mon began their attacks. Number 6
spit acid at the Oozaru, but it simply batted it aside with it's paw.
It then picked up up the snake-pok�mon and held it with both hands.
With a bestial roar, it snapped the Jinzoupok�mon like a dry twig.
"My Number 6!!" cried Magenta as the two halves of her pokemon fell,
still squirming, to the earth.
Number 7 flew up to the Oozaru's face and discharged poison gas. The
giant monkey stood still for a moment, then suddenly sneezed. The
poison gas dispersed into the air and the flying pok�mon flew backward
into the groud, creating a small crater. As the Oozaru rubbed it's
nose, Number 7 slowly lifted itself back into the air and again flew up
to the creature's face. However, before it could attack, the Oozaru
opened it's mouth and chomped with it's powerful incisors. Number 7
never stood a chance as the giant monkey slowly chewed, and then
swallowed its foe.
"Number 7!" cried the understandibly upset Cornflower. The two Red
Rocket Army members looked up at the giant monkey, and made the only
logical decision.
"Run!!" they cried together, and started to make their escape.
"Come back here you cowards!" yelled Meowth, shaking his fist after
them. Suddenly he felt the hair on the back of his neck rise, and he
turned around to see the giant Oozaru that had come up directly behind
him.
"Um, well, on second thought, maybe running isn't such a bad idea," he
remarked, casually backing away from the giant simian. However, before
he could escape the Oozaru grabbed him by the tail and swung him around
in a circle. The Oozaru then roared and threw Meowth straight at the
rapidly retreating Red Rocket Army, hitting them, and sending them into
orbit.
"Looks like we're blasting off again!!" they cried as they disappeared
into the distance.
Yamucha and Bulma had watched the entire battle. However, now that the
Red Rocket Army was gone, the Oozaru turned to look at them.
"Um, nice Oozaru?" said Bulma hopefully. The Oozaru roared.
"What can we do?" she cried, grabbing Yamucha by the shoulders.
"Aaaaah!" he yelled, his body stiffening up. He then immediately
fainted.
"What's wrong with you!!" Bulma yelled, but Yamucha couldn't hear her.
She looked up at the giant Oozaru with dread.
"GOKU!! Where are you!?!" she called, hopefully, but there was no
answer except the savage roar of the Oozaru.
"We're doomed," she said to herself. Bulma watched in horror as the
Oozaru advanced, and she closed her eyes, waiting for the inevitable.
It never came. Finally, she opened her eyes. The giant monster was
gone. Bulma stood up, shakily, and looked around. The remains of the
Jinzoupok�mon still lay on the ground, but the Oozaru seemed to have
vanished without a trace. Then she say Goku. He was lying not far
away, face down in the sand. And strangely enough, he was missing all
his clothes. His Pok� Ball lay near his hand.
Bulma picked up Goku's Pok� Ball. She stared at it for a long moment.
Then, for reasons she couldn't explain, she pressed the button to
release the Legendary Pok�mon. It popped open and nothing happened.
It was empty.
"How is this possible?" she asked herself. Then she looked at Goku,
lying unconcious on the ground.
"Goku? Could it be?" To tired to think, Bulma sat down in the shade of
the remains of the rock to rest while she waited for Goku and Yamucha to
wake up. She had a feeling that Goku was going to be hungry.
